September 15, 2020A: Florida DFS-licensed title agencies, located in and outside Florida, are required to submit information (“The Data Call”) about their businesses to the Florida Office of Insurance Regulation (OIR). OIR reviews the data collected to determine whether adjustments should be made to the Florida promulgated title premium rates.
All title agencies holding a license in the 2019 calendar year are required to participate in the Data Call. The deadline for the 2019 Data Call submission was extended to September 1, 2020. An agent’s license can be suspended by OIR for failure to meet the Data Call deadline. Attorneys licensed by the Florida Bar and law firms are not required to participate in the Data Call.
The Data Call is submitted through the on-line Insurance Regulation Filing System (“IRFS”). To access the system, you can copy and paste the following link into your search engine:
Make sure to allow yourself time to register for access to IRFS and complete the Data Call by the September 1, 2020 deadline. A How To Guide is available at :
